Which type of heat detector uses wire or tubing along the ceiling of large open areas?

Explanation:
Line detectors, also called linear heat detectors, are designed to cover large, open spaces by running a heat-sensitive element along the ceiling. As heat from a fire raises the temperature along the line, the system trips wherever the line reaches its activation point, providing broad area coverage with relatively few devices. This makes them ideal for open areas like warehouses or hangars where placing many spot detectors would be impractical. Fixed-temperature heat detectors trigger at a set temperature at a single point, spot detectors are individual units placed in various locations, and photoelectric detectors sense smoke, not heat.
